Abstract
In an injection molding system, a rack on which a peripheral device can be mounted includes a fixing unit for removably fixing to a machine stool of an injection molding machine and a moving unit for making the rack movable alone. Accordingly, maintenance of the injection molding machine can be performed satisfactorily and positioning work is also made easier so that the rack can be transported easily.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S
(12) FIG. 1 is a diagram showing an appearance of a conventional injection molding system. The injection molding machine mainly includes an injection device 122, a clamping device 124, and a machine stool 120. The injection device 122 and the clamping device 124 are placed on the machine stool 120. A rack 110 is provided like surrounding the clamping device 124 and the rack 110 is fixed to the machine stool 120. A molded product extraction device 112 is fixed onto the rack 110 and has a function to extract a molded product molded by the injection device 122 and the clamping device 124 from the mold. A conventional procedure, which is publicly known, can be used to mold a molded product using the injection device 122 and the clamping device 124 in the injection molding machine and thus, the description thereof is omitted.
(13) FIG. 2 is a diagram showing the rack 110 and the molded product extraction device 112 in FIG. 1 by extracting therefrom. The rack 110 has a portal shape in a direction opposite to a clamping direction of the clamping device 124 when mounted on the injection molding machine and a lower portion thereof can be fixed to the machine stool 120 by a fixing unit 111. Bolts or the like are used as the fixing unit 111. The molded product extraction device 112 is constructed of a robot and a molded product after being molded can be extracted from inside the mold of the injection molding machine by a hand attached to the tip portion of the robot being moved for gripping.
(14) FIG. 3 is a diagram showing a safety fence 130 surrounding the molded product extraction device 112. The injection molding machine vibrates frequently because the motor moves or a large force is frequently added to the injection molding machine and the box shape as shown in FIG. 3 is adopted for the safety fence 130 in most cases. FIG. 4 shows a state in which the safety fence 130 shown in FIG. 3 is mounted around the molded product extraction device 112. The safety fence 130 is constructed such that the entire construction is placed on the clamping device 124. In the conventional example, the safety fence 130 is provided above the clamping device 124 placed on the machine stool 120 and thus, it may be difficult to mount the safety fence 130 and when the mechanism unit of the injection molding machine is maintained, the maintenance may be hindered by the safety fence 130.
(15) In view of the above problems, an embodiment of the present invention will be described below based on drawings. FIG. 5 is a diagram showing the appearance of an injection molding system according to the present embodiment and FIG. 6 is a diagram showing a rack 10 by extracting from FIG. 5.
(16) The injection molding machine mainly includes an injection device 22, a clamping device 24, and a machine stool 20 and the injection device 22 and the clamping device 24 are placed on the machine stool 20. A molded product extraction device 12, a static eliminator 14, and a molded product containing box 16 are provided on the top surface of the rack 10. In the lower row of the rack 10, a molded product extraction control device 18 to control the molded product extraction device 12 is provided. Further, a roller 11 is provided in the lowest portion of the rack 10 so that the rack 10 alone is movable. Instead of the roller 11, wheels or the like may be used as a mechanism to move the rack 10. The molded product extraction device 12 may be constructed of a robot or a common extraction device.
(17) The rack 10 is provided with an opening on the side opposite to the machine stool 20 of the injection molding machine. By moving the rack 10 appropriately, the opening can be positioned such that the clamping device 24 of the injection molding machine goes into the rack 10 therethrough. Also on the side opposite to the machine stool 20 of the injection molding machine of the rack 10, a mounting position 15 where the rack 10 and the machine stool 20 are fixed is provided and side face portions of the rack 10 and the machine stool 20 are fixed by a fixing member 13. When compared with a conventional example, the rack can be fixed to the side face portion of the machine stool 20 at an appropriate height by the fixing member, which facilitates the fixing work.
(18) FIG. 7 is a diagram showing a state in which a safety fence 30 is provided on the rack 10 in FIG. 6. FIGS. 8 and 9 are diagrams showing a state in which the rack 10 is fixed to the machine stool 20 of the injection molding machine while the safety fence 30 is provided. As shown in FIG. 7, even if the safety fence 30 is provided on the rack 10, the rack 10 can run autonomously. In a state in which combined with the injection molding machine, as shown in FIGS. 8 and 9, the molded product extraction device 12 is covered with the safety fence 30 above the clamping device 24 of the injection molding machine. With the molded product extraction device 12 and the like configured to be arranged above the clamping device 24 of the injection molding machine, in contrast to an injection device provided with a hopper or the like, the space above the clamping device 24, which is normally a dead space, can effectively be used.
(19) As shown in FIG. 9, the safety fence 30 is provided with an opening on the side opposite to the injection molding machine. In addition, rails (not shown) are provided in the left and right direction on a top surface portion of the rack 10 and rollers (not shown) meshing with the rails are provided below the safety fence 30 so that a slide mechanism is constructed of the rails and rollers. Accordingly, the safety fence 30 is configured to be able to slide in a direction opposite to the injection molding machine. Accordingly, as shown in FIG. 10, the molded product extraction device 12 can be exposed to the outside from inside the safety fence 30 by sliding the safety fence 30. Therefore, maintenance of each mechanism such as performing maintenance of a molded product by exposing the molded product extraction device 12 to the outside and replacing the mold of the injection molding machine by moving the position of the safety fence 30 can easily be performed.
